Biewer Wisconsin Sawmill is looking to add a full-time Industrial Electrician to our team in Prentice, WI The position will be responsible for the installation, maintenance, and repair of electrical systems and equipment in an industrial setting reading blueprints, troubleshooting complex controls (PLCs), and ensuring compliance with all safety codes.

* * Accountabilities
* Primary responsibilities will include:
● Install, maintain, repair and modify industrial electrical wiring, equipment, instrumentation in accordance with relevant codes and from blueprints, schematics and sketches.
● Troubleshoot production equipment (high-voltage systems, motors, switches, starters, and control panel wiring) using electrical and mechanical aptitude.
● Diagnose repairs and offer recommendations for process flow improvements to industrial control systems, analog and digital applications.
● Performing preventative maintenance.
● Collaborating with other trades to keep heavy machinery running efficiently and safely.
* Qualifications
* ● Experience in heavy industrial environment and proficient computer skills.
● Strong troubleshooting and problem solving skills with various industrial contract, and reading prints/schematics.
● Basic hydraulic and mechanical knowledge.
● Basic electrical theory/circuits;
De-energization/Lockout
● Applications of Industrial Sensors - Infrared, Proximity, Limit Switches, etc.
* Certifications,
Education and Experience:
* ● Two years of formal technical training in the principles of electricity and electrical design or five (5) years of electrical systems in a manufacturing environment. xrlwcon
● State electrical license or certificate desired.
